How to Make Creamy Boursin Chicken Pasta
Quick Overview
Creamy Boursin Chicken Pasta is a delightful dish featuring tender chicken pieces and pasta enveloped in a rich, creamy sauce made from Boursin cheese. Prepare to whip up this decadent meal in just 30 minutes—it’s simple, delicious, and utterly satisfying.
Key Ingredients for Creamy Boursin Chicken Pasta
To create this mouthwatering dish, gather the following ingredients:
- 8 ounces of fettuccine pasta
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 pound of boneless, skinless chicken breasts, cubed
- 4 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 package (5.2 oz) of Boursin cheese
- 1 cup heavy cream
- 2 cups baby spinach (optional)
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Fresh parsley for garnish (optional)
Step-by-Step Instructions:
- Cook the Pasta: In a large pot, bring salted water to a boil and cook the fettuccine according to package instructions. Drain and set aside.
- Sauté the Chicken: In a large skillet,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add the cubed chicken, seasoned with salt and pepper. Cook for about 5-7 minutes or until the chicken is browned and cooked through. Remove the chicken and set it aside.
- Prepare the Sauce: In the same skillet, add minced garlic and sauté for about 1 minute until fragrant. Reduce the heat to low, and add the Boursin cheese and heavy cream, stirring until smooth.
- Combine: Add the cooked fettuccine and chicken to the skillet and toss to coat with the sauce. If using, stir in the baby spinach until it wilts.
- Serve: Garnish with fresh parsley if desired, and serve immediately. Enjoy your creamy delight!

Top Tips for Perfecting Creamy Boursin Chicken Pasta
- Ingredient Substitutions: If you can’t find Boursin cheese, try using another soft cheese like herb-infused cream cheese or goat cheese.
- Cooking Chicken: Ensure the chicken is in bite-sized pieces for even cooking.
- Don’t Overcook Your Pasta: Keep it al dente; it’ll continue to cook when combined with the sauce.
- Adding Veggies: Feel free to toss in some peas or mushrooms for added texture and flavor.
Storing and Reheating Tips
Leftovers? Yes, please! Store any uneaten Creamy Boursin Chicken Pasta in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. For longer storage, it can be frozen for up to 2 months. When you’re ready to enjoy it again, reheat in a skillet over low heat until warmed through, adding a splash of milk or cream to restore the sauce’s creaminess, if needed.
